Initializing a new repository: git init To create a new repo, you'll use the git init command. git init is a one-time command you use during the initial setup of a new repo. Executing this command will create a new .git subdirectory in your current working directory.

WebYou can choose one of these methods by setting a Git configuration value: $ git config --global credential.helper cache Some of these helpers have options. The “store” helper can take a --file argument, which customizes where the plain-text file is saved (the default is ~/.git-credentials ).
